About The Position

Based in Syracuse, NY, the Nursing Home Surveyor/Complaint Investigator will assist with the surveillance and investigation activities related to nursing homes (long-term care). These activities are mandated to evaluate facility performance and monitor the quality of care and services provided. In this role you will participate as a member of an interdisciplinary survey/investigation team to review allegations of abuse and neglect, perform surveillance activities/tasks at nursing homes (long term care)/Transitional Care Units (TCUs), and Adult Day Health Care Programs (ADHCP) to determine compliance with the requirements of participation; prepare written reports of investigative findings and prepare Statement of Deficiencies (SOD) within required time frame, using Principles of Documentation; participate in emergency surveys at Skilled Nursing Facilities (SNF's); participate in State monitoring during Immediate Jeopardy situations; as well as other duties.

Responsibilities

  • Participate in surveys or complaint investigations, including allegations of abuse and neglect, and perform surveillance activities/tasks at nursing homes (long-term care) to determine compliance with federal and state regulations.
  • Produce written documentation and draft a Statement of Deficiencies (SOD) within the required time frame, using Principles of Documentation.
  • Assess compliance with the Plan of Correction within the required time frame.
  • Complete data entry in federal and state reporting databases as required.
  • Participate in state monitoring during immediate jeopardy situations.
  • Attend meetings as required.
  • Testify in administrative hearings as needed.
